how does atp supply energy for cellular activities?
by breaking off a phosphate group from its structure
by releasing the sugar molecule from its structure
by adding a phosphate group to its structure
by attaching itself to a glucose molecule
ATP (adenosine triphosphate) has three phosphate groups. When the bond holding the out - most phosphate group is broken (hydrolysis), energy is released. This is how ATP supplies energy for cellular activities. Adding a phosphate group (to form ATP from ADP) stores energy, not releases it. Releasing the sugar molecule or attaching to a glucose molecule is not the way ATP supplies energy.
